- Disease spot annotation
- Production of leaf foreground image: the label image obtained after the labeling of the leaf will be converted into a binary image to obtain a mask image of the leaf, and then it will be bit-operated with the original image to obtain an image containing only the foreground of the leaf.
- Extraction of the super green features of the image: calculation of the vegetation index EXG of the foreground image of the leaf, as well as the transformation of its color space from three channels to a single channel to obtain a greyscale image.
- Acquisition of non-spotted areas: set the gray value of the pixels with a gray value between 30 and 200 to 0 and the rest to 255. The image is changed from a grey-scale image to a binary image with a black background and diseased areas in white and non-diseased areas in black.
- Get the diseased area: the non-diseased area and the leaf mask image are bit-operated, and then morphological operations are performed to eliminate the fine outline of the leaf edge to obtain a complete mask image of the diseased area.
- Creating a labeled image of the spot: iterate through all the pixels of the image, reassigning those with a gray value of 255 for all three channels—r, g, and b. Pixels with a gray value of 255 are reassigned.

4. Conclusions and Prospect
4.1. Conclusions
- (1)
- The MobileNet, ShuffleNet, GhostNet, and SqueezeNet pre-trained models, based on the ImageNet dataset, were migrated to the fine-grained classification task using migration training and evaluated comprehensively based on several metrics, including classification accuracy and model complexity. In comparison, the 0.75 MobileNetV3l model has the lowest number of parameters, the ShuffleNetV2 2× model has the fastest inference speed on GPU and CPU, and the GhostNet model has the highest accuracy. Finally, the ShuffleNetV2 2× model, which offers faster CPU inference speed, is chosen as the basic model while ensuring classification accuracy.
- (2)
- The ShuffleNetV2 2× model was improved by introducing the attention mechanism and adjusting the network structure, and the improvement strategies were: introducing the attention mechanism module, reducing the network depth, and decreasing the number of 1 × 1 convolutions. Compared with the base model, the number of parameters and computational effort of the improved model are substantially reduced, while the classification accuracy increases by 0.85%, and the inference speed on the CPU increases from 25.7 frames per second to 30.2 frames per second. The improved model better balances infer time and accuracy under the premise of reducing model complexity.
- (3)
- The improved model was deployed and tested in an embedded device, and the overall classification precision was 94%, the average time required for single image detection was 3.27 s, and it had high recognition precision and fast detection speed, which provided important technical support to realize automatic identification of potato late blight diseases.
4.2. Prospect
- (1)
- Enhanced Dataset: Recognizing the importance of data quality and diversity, we will emphasize the need for expanding the potato late blight dataset. This can include gathering more labeled images from different regions, capturing variations in lighting conditions, and incorporating images with different stages and severities of late blight infection.
- (2)
- Multi-Disease Detection: Given the overlap of symptoms in various plant diseases, we will discuss the possibility of extending the developed deep learning model to detect other plant diseases or multiple diseases simultaneously. This expansion would provide a comprehensive solution for agricultural disease management.
